Memory Card Folder Structure

The images on a memory card are placed in subfolders of the [DCIM] folder labeled 
[xxxCANON], where the "xxx" represents a number in the range 100 - 999.

• *Files with the THM extension are the thumbnail image files for the camera's index replay 
mode. If you delete these files, you will be unable to save the movies to the camera from a 
computer.
• The "xxxx" in file names represent four-digit numbers.
• **Each successive file shot in Stitch Assist mode is assigned a letter starting from "A," which 
is inserted as the third digit in the name. i.e. [STA_0001.JPG], [STB_0002.JPG], 
[STC_0003.JPG]...
• All folders except the "xxxCANON" folders contain image settings files. Do not open or delete 
them.
